Park Ridge unfortunately couldn't capitalize on their home-field advantage in their season opener. They took a 13-6 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Garfield Boilermakers on Friday. Sadly, the defeat continues a streak the team started last season, making it four in a row.
Aidan O'Connor threw for 73 yards on six of 12 attempts. Matthew Grant was his top target, picking up 35 receiving yards. On the ground, Michael Shahinian rushed for 98 yards and one touchdown.
The victory got Garfield back to even at 1-1.
Park Ridge and Garfield will both get their first taste of in-conference action in their upcoming games. The Owls are set to face off against their familiar foe Weehawken at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Meanwhile, Garfield will square off against rival Palisades Park/Leonia on Friday.
